Doc is at it again starting that BS.
BPG - Gobert #2, Simmons #62
DREB - Gobert #1, Simmons # 87
DREB% - Gobert #3, Simmons # 47
BLK% - Gobert #4, Simmons #64
DefWS - Gobert #1, Simmons # 15
DBPM - Gobert #6, Simmons #9
DTRG - Gobert # 2, Simmons # 16

Ben's dramatically IMPROVED his defense. His award MID (Most Improved Defender) or hell, give him another ROY award, but don't take the DPOY away from Rudy, he's clearly earned it.
